Output 65f244b9ec0ee836cd17836f1c4d5b9ba254c7cc2bd85b20ace3f2c3e9b59dc9:0

value
4085093007
script pubkey
OP_0 OP_PUSHBYTES_20 468368bbe76edd0ec1b12e22ac4fc88b9253e07d
address
tb1qg6pk3wl8dmwsasd39c32cn7g3wf98craa9lv7z
transaction
65f244b9ec0ee836cd17836f1c4d5b9ba254c7cc2bd85b20ace3f2c3e9b59dc9
confirmations
106574
spent
true